The Blue Squirrel Cafe
The Blue Squirrel Cafe on E. Main Street in downtown Saluda, North Carolina is located right across the street from Green River Adventures. Carryout food only. But no worries, as you can still enjoy your meal on their large open air, covered deck!
Located in Saluda, North Carolina, the Blue Squirrel Cafe offers a variety of wraps, sandwiches, and personal pizzas. Plenty of vegetarian options are available as well.
Saluda Whistle Stop Pizza & Wings
After working up an appetite at the Gorge Zipline or Green River Adventures, drive a minute up the road for some meaty wings and pizza! Not ready to eat yet? Order takeout and have a glass of wine, or try the local craft beers on tap. If you want to taste a variety of craft beers, order the beer flights and sample as many you'd like.
Ward's Grill
Ward's Grill is located on Main Street, in downtown Saluda; it is connected to Thompson's Store, which is the oldest grocery store in North Carolina. Breakfast and lunch are served daily from 7-3. May - October, the diner is open on Sundays 11-4. This is a 50's style diner, serving homemade desserts, milkshakes, and standard diner fare. They are famous for their CJ burger, which is a mixture of beef and "Charlie's sage sausage." Definitely stop in, especially if you are visiting the Gorge Zipline, or Green River Adventures in Saluda. This is where the locals eat!
Green River Barbeque
Green River Barbeque in Saluda, is a 5 minute drive from the Gorge Zipline, and Green River Adventures. In addition to your typical BBQ fare, they have other options such as burgers, chicken and turkey sandwiches, seafood, and much more. Green River Barbeque in Saluda, has both indoor and outdoor dining; beer and wine are also available.
The Purple Onion
The Purple Onion in downtown Saluda, is about a 30 minute drive from A Touch of Luxury Cabin. Certain evenings, the restaurant has live music; check their music calendar to purchase tickets. They are open daily for lunch and dinner. The Purple Onion in Saluda serves appetizers, salads, sandwiches, pizza, and dinner entrees; gluten free and vegan options are also available. With the exception of Saturday nights, (which is first come, first serve) lunch and dinner reservations can be made online. The Purple Onion offers both outdoor and indoor dining.

Wildflour Bakery & Cafe
The Wildflour Bakery & Cafe in Saluda, is right under 30 minutes from A Touch of Luxury Cabin. This is a great place to have breakfast, before heading out to the Gorge Zipline, or kayaking at Green River Adventures in Saluda. Their lunch menu has a variety of salads, sandwiches, and wraps. The Wildflour Bakery has been in business for 37 years. Wednesday and Friday are pizza nights, where they serve pizza from 5-8 p.m. On Sundays, they offer a limited brunch menu, in addition to the regular menu. Stop in to pick up fresh bread loaves, and desserts to take home with you. Be sure to check their website for hours, as they change daily. Locals love this place!
